The unemployment rate among those referred to as "Gulf War Era II Veterans" -- veterans who have served on active duty since 2001 -- fell to 7.2% in 2014, according to data released last month by the Bureau of Labor Statistics, while the jobless rate among all veterans dropped to 5.3%.
As of 2014, 21.2 million people–9% of the civilian population over the age of 18–are veterans, defined as men and women who have previously served on active military duty in the U.S. armed forces and are now civilians.
Many companies are eager to capitalize on the technical, leadership, and process management skills of those with military experience. To determine the top employers for veterans, compensation information site Payscale.com took a look at companies hiring the most veterans for work in which military experience is highly relevant.
This ranking is focused exclusively on employers seeking skilled labor. As a result, some major American employers, such as Wal-Mart, do not appear on this list, despite the fact that they employ greater numbers of military veterans in unskilled capacities.
Within the list, companies are ranked by how many veterans they employ.

Booz Allen takes fourth place this year, representing the Weapons and Security industry alongside companies like SAIC, BAE Systems, and L-3 Communications. Among others, these companies seek intelligence analysts and management consultants, roles that pay from $71,000 to more than $100,000 per year.
Veterans seeking government jobs will find demand in the medical field, with jobs like licensed practical nurse and medical support assistant paying those with five to eight years of experience more modest salaries in the $30,000s and registered nurses earning closer to $60,000.
The Top 15 Employers For Veterans
1. Lockheed Martin Corp.
Industry: Aerospace/Engineering
2. The Boeing Company
Industry: Aerospace/Engineering
3. Northrop Grumman Corporation
Industry: Aerospace/Engineering
4. Booz Allen Hamilton
Industry: Weapons and Security
5. U.S. Department of Defense
Industry: Government Agency
6. Science Applications International Corporation (SAIC)
Industry: Weapons and Security
7. BAE Systems Inc.
Industry: Weapons and Security
8. Department of Veterans Affairs
Industry: Government Agency
9. L-3 Communications
Industry: Weapons and Security
10. Computer Sciences Corporation (CSC)
Industry: Information Technology
11. Raytheon Co.
Industry: Weapons and Security
12. General Electric Co.
Industry: Aerospace/Engineering
13. General Dynamics Information Technology
Industry: Information Technology
14. CACI International Inc.
Industry: Information Technology
15. International Business Machines (IBM)
Industry: Information Technology
